Here are the four general acid reactions.

Acid + Base = Salr + Water

Acid + Alkali = Salt + Water

Acid + Metal = Salt + Hydrogen

Acid + Carbonate = Salt + Water + Carbon dioxide.

NB An Alkali is a soliuble base.

Which general equation shows a single-displacement reaction?

The general equation for a single displacement reaction is: A + BC → AC + B. This type of reaction occurs when one element displaces another in a compound, resulting in the formation of a new compound and a free element.

What is the general formula of a chemical equation?

Generally it is REACTANTS ===> Products Symbollically it can be written as A + B = C + D Where 'A' & 'B' are the reactants and 'C' and 'D' are the products, NB All Chemical reactions obey the Law of CONSERVATION of MASS. So the total of the masses on both sides of the equation MUST be equal . This leads to all chemlcal reaction equations MUST be balanced , because each symbol no only represents an element but also represents a mass. ; Different elements have different masses. But overall the tota, ON BOTH sidesL must BE Equal. e.g. 20 g of A + 15 g of B = 30g of 'C' + 5g of 'D'. 20 + 15 = 30 + 5 = 35 Similarly 2NaOH + H2SO4 = Na2SO4 + 2H2O Notice there are 2 sodiums(Na) on both sides (2 x 23 = 46) 6 oxygens on both sides (6 x 16 = 96) 4 hydrogens on both sides ( 4 x 1 = 4) 1 sulphur on both ( 32 x 1 = 32). Since each element has its own atomic mass , the numbers of each element are the same on both sides, then it follows that the total masses are the samer on both sides. Hence the Law of CONSERVATION of MASS is obeyed. S

What is the general equation for all enzymatic reactions?

The general equation for all enzymatic reactions is: Substrate + Enzyme → Enzyme-Substrate Complex → Enzyme + Product. Enzymes catalyze reactions by lowering the activation energy required for the reaction to occur, thereby increasing the rate of the reaction.
